The sounds and image of a nap. The space between wakefulness and sleep. Sixteen layers of video shot with a macro lens then digitally stitched together to create a pillow that moves, vibrates, evokes respiration. The audio is composed of layers of sound found in the artist’s bedroom and in the backyards of Brooklyn. With signed certificate of authenticity.
Stefanie Koseff was born in New Jersey in 1974 and lives and works in Brooklyn. With a background in traditional filmmaking, her work explores non-traditonal ways of using the moving image, from projection design for live performance to hand-made interactive video players. Her work has been shown at the The 3LD Art & Technology Center in New York City, BKBX Gallery, Open Source Gallery and the Williamsburg Art and Historical Center in Brooklyn, NY.
